PackageDescriptionH5py provides a simple, robust read/write interface to HDF5 data from Python. Existing Python and Numpy concepts are used for the interface; for example, datasets on disk are represented by a proxy class that supports slicing, and has dtype and shape attributes. HDF5 groups are presented using a dictionary metaphor, indexed by name.
